Yes, "fax" is short for "fascimile".

Generally, a fax is referred to only in terms of the electronic transmission known as faxing. It is not used in any other areas of language.

A fascimile is a term used in the same way for faxing as well, however it is also used in a wider range areas to mean a reproduction or clone or copy - one example would be art (a fascimile would be a reproduction of an art piece).

The word fascimile can be used almost anywhere the word fax is used, but not the other way around.
